What is Uipl.dll?

A DLL (Dynamic Link Library) file is like a set of instructions that different programs can use. It contains code and data that can be used by more than one program at the same time. For instance, uipl.dll is a DLL file that is used by the software Ulead PhotoImpact 11 to perform specific functions.

This file is important because it provides the necessary code for the Ulead PhotoImpact 11 software to carry out tasks related to image processing and editing. Specifically, uipl.dll helps Ulead PhotoImpact 11 to handle graphic and image-related operations such as importing, editing, and exporting images. Without this DLL file, the Ulead PhotoImpact 11 software may not be able to perform these functions properly.

DLL files often play a critical role in system operations. Despite their importance, these files can sometimes source system errors. Below we consider some of the most frequently encountered faults associated with DLL files.

  • The file uipl.dll is missing: The error indicates that the DLL file, essential for the proper function of an application or the system itself, is not located in its expected directory.
  • Cannot register uipl.dll: This denotes a failure in the system's attempt to register the DLL file, which might occur if the DLL file is damaged, if the system lacks the necessary permissions, or if there's a conflict with another registered DLL.
  • Uipl.dll Access Violation: This indicates a process tried to access or modify a memory location related to uipl.dll that it isn't allowed to. This is often a sign of problems with the software using the DLL, such as bugs or corruption.
  • Uipl.dll is either not designed to run on Windows or it contains an error: This message implies that there could be an error within the DLL file, or the DLL is not compatible with the Windows version you're running. This could occur if there's a mismatch between the DLL file and the Windows version or system architecture.
  • This application failed to start because uipl.dll was not found. Re-installing the application may fix this problem: This error message is a sign that a DLL file that the application relies on is not present in the system. Reinstalling the application may install the missing DLL file and fix the problem.
